﻿@charset "utf-8";
/* CSS Document */
*{padding:0; margin:0;}
/*ul,li{ list-style-type:none; float:left;}*/
body{font-size:12px; font-family:'宋体';}
a{ text-decoration:none; border:none; outline:none;}
img{ border:none;}
p{font-family: "微软雅黑", "microsoft yahei";font-size: 16px;line-height: 2em;text-indent: 30px;}
table p{text-indent:0px;}
.fl-1{text-align: left;float: left;}
.fr-1{text-align: right;float: right;}
.img1{	text-align: center;	text-indent: 0em;}
body {
	font-family: source-sans-pro;
	background-color: #f2f2f2;
	margin-top: 0px;
	margin-right: 0px;
	margin-bottom: 0px;
	margin-left: 0px;
	font-style: normal;
	font-weight: 200;
}
.container {
	width: 100%;
	margin-left: auto;
	margin-right: auto;
	/*height: 1000px;*/
	background-color: #FFFFFF;
}
header {
	width: 1000px;
	height: 110px; /*5%;*/
	background-color: #fff;
	/*border-bottom: 1px solid #2C9AB7;*/
	margin: 0 auto;
}
.logo_l {
	color: #ccc;
	font-weight: bold;
	text-align: undefined;
	/*width: 10%;*/
	float: left;
	margin-top: 5px;
	margin-left: 5px;
	letter-spacing: 4px;
}
.logo_r {
	color: #ccc;
	font-weight: bold;
	text-align: undefined;
	/*width: 10%;*/
	float: left;
	margin-top: 30px;
	margin-left: 3px;
	letter-spacing: 4px;
}
nav#header_nav {
	float: right;
	width: 150px;
	text-align: right;
	margin-right: 15px;
	margin-top: 65px;
}
header nav#header_nav ul {
	list-style: none;
	float: right;	
}
nav#header_nav ul li {
	float: left;
	color: #ccc;
	width: 30px;
	font-size: 14px;
	text-align: left;
	margin-right: 15px;
	letter-spacing: 2px;
	font-weight: bold;
	transition: all 0.3s linear;
}
ul li a {
	color: #111;
	text-decoration: none;
}
ul li:hover a {
	color: #2C9AB7;
}
.about {
	padding-left: 0;
	padding-right: 0;
	padding-top: 0;
	display: inline-block;
	background-color: #FFFFFF;
	margin: 0 auto;
}
.clearboth {
	height: 0; clear: both;
}


#nav{width:100%; height:58px; background:#940214;}
.nav{width:900px; height:58px; line-height:58px; overflow:hidden; margin:0 auto; }
.nav ul#navMenu{width: 980px; margin: 0 auto;}
.nav ul#navMenu li{background:url(../images/nav_right.jpg) no-repeat left center; }
.nav ul#navMenu li.top{background-image: none; }
.nav ul#navMenu li a{width:111px; height:58px; overflow:hidden; display:block; text-align:center; font-family:'微软雅黑'; font-size:14px; font-weight:bold; color:#fff; }
.nav ul#navMenu li a:hover{ color:#000; background:#fff;}
.dropMenu {position:absolute; top:0; z-index:9999; width:111px; visibility: hidden; background:#fff; filter:Alpha(Opacity=80); margin-top:-1px;}
.dropMenu li {width:111px; height:29px; line-height:28px;}
.dropMenu li a {width:111px; height:28px; line-height:28px; display: block; color:#000; text-align:center;  border-bottom:1px dotted #ccc;  background:#fff;}
.dropMenu li a:hover {color:#fff; background:#228ac8; font-weight:bold;}


.ind-banner {width:1000px; height:255px; margin:0 auto; z-index:-1;}
.inpic-tab{width:100%; min-width:1000px; height:255px; margin: 0 auto; overflow: hidden; position:relative;}
.auto-bind-widget { width:100%; height:255px; margin: 0 auto; position: relative;}
ul.slide-list li{display:block; position:absolute; width: 100%; height: 255px;}
ul.slide-list li a {position:absolute; top:0; left:100%; margin-left:-1000px;}
.switchable-triggerBox{position: absolute; top:220px; left:0; width:100%; height:16px; z-index:0; font-size:0; line-height:0; text-align:center;}
.switchable-triggerBox span {display:inline-block; width:9px; height:9px; margin:0 8px 0 0; background: url("../images/right.png") no-repeat 0 0; text-align:center;}
.switchable-triggerBox span.active{background: url("../images/left.png") no-repeat 0 0;}

.gallery{
	width: 1000px;
	margin: 0 auto;
	padding: 0;
}
#kjcd{width:1000px; height:130px; overflow:hidden; margin:20px auto 0 auto; overflow:hidden;}
#kjcd ul{width:1000px; margin: 0 auto;}
#kjcd ul li{width:121px; height:121px; overflow:hidden; margin-bottom:25px;
	line-height: 210px; text-align: center;color: #111;
}
#kjcd ul li a{ display:block; width:93px; height:121px; margin:0 auto;color:#111;}
#kjcd ul li a.a1{background:url(../images/kjcd.jpg) no-repeat left top;}
#kjcd ul li a.a1:hover{background:url(../images/kjcd.jpg) no-repeat left bottom;}
#kjcd ul li a.a2{background:url(../images/kjcd.jpg) no-repeat -93px top;}
#kjcd ul li a.a2:hover{background:url(../images/kjcd.jpg) no-repeat -93px bottom;}
#kjcd ul li a.a3{background:url(../images/kjcd.jpg) no-repeat -186px top;}
#kjcd ul li a.a3:hover{background:url(../images/kjcd.jpg) no-repeat -186px bottom;}
#kjcd ul li a.a4{background:url(../images/kjcd.jpg) no-repeat -279px top;}
#kjcd ul li a.a4:hover{background:url(../images/kjcd.jpg) no-repeat -279px bottom;}
#kjcd ul li a.a5{background:url(../images/kjcd.jpg) no-repeat -372px top;}
#kjcd ul li a.a5:hover{background:url(../images/kjcd.jpg) no-repeat -372px bottom;}
#kjcd ul li a.a6{background:url(../images/kjcd.jpg) no-repeat -465px top;}
#kjcd ul li a.a6:hover{background:url(../images/kjcd.jpg) no-repeat -465px bottom;}
#kjcd ul li a.a7{background:url(../images/kjcd.jpg) no-repeat -558px top;}
#kjcd ul li a.a7:hover{background:url(../images/kjcd.jpg) no-repeat -558px bottom;}
#kjcd ul li a.a8{background:url(../images/kjcd.jpg) no-repeat -651px top;}
#kjcd ul li a.a8:hover{background:url(../images/kjcd.jpg) no-repeat -651px bottom;}
#kjcd ul li a.a9{background:url(../images/kjcd.jpg) no-repeat -744px top;}
#kjcd ul li a.a9:hover{background:url(../images/kjcd.jpg) no-repeat -744px bottom;}
#kjcd ul li a.a10{background:url(../images/kjcd.jpg) no-repeat -837px top;}
#kjcd ul li a.a10:hover{background:url(../images/kjcd.jpg) no-repeat -837px bottom;}
#kjcd ul li a.a11{background:url(../images/kjcd.jpg) no-repeat -930px top;}
#kjcd ul li a.a11:hover{background:url(../images/kjcd.jpg) no-repeat -930px bottom;}
#kjcd ul li a.a12{background:url(../images/kjcd.jpg) no-repeat -1023px top;}
#kjcd ul li a.a12:hover{background:url(../images/kjcd.jpg) no-repeat -1023px bottom;}
#kjcd ul li a.a13{background:url(../images/kjcd.jpg) no-repeat -1116px top;}
#kjcd ul li a.a13:hover{background:url(../images/kjcd.jpg) no-repeat -1116px bottom;}
#kjcd ul li a.a14{background:url(../images/kjcd.jpg) no-repeat -1209px top;}
#kjcd ul li a.a14:hover{background:url(../images/kjcd.jpg) no-repeat -1209px bottom;}
#kjcd ul li a.a15{background:url(../images/kjcd.jpg) no-repeat -1302px top;}
#kjcd ul li a.a15:hover{background:url(../images/kjcd.jpg) no-repeat -1302px bottom;}
#kjcd ul li a.a16{background:url(../images/kjcd.jpg) no-repeat -1395px top;}
#kjcd ul li a.a16:hover{background:url(../images/kjcd.jpg) no-repeat -1395px bottom;}
#kjcd ul li a.a17{background:url(../images/kjcd.jpg) no-repeat -1488px top;}
#kjcd ul li a.a17:hover{background:url(../images/kjcd.jpg) no-repeat -1488px bottom;}
#kjcd ul li a:hover{filter:alpha(opacity=80); -moz-opacity:0.8; opacity: 0.8;}

.main_2{margin: 12px auto;width: 976px;}
.main_2l{float:left; width: 485px;}
.main_2r{float:right; width: 485px;/*padding-left:15px;*/}
.main_3{margin: 12px auto;width: 976px;}
.main_3l{margin: 0 3 0 0; float:left;width: 325px;}
.main_3m{margin: 0 5 0 2; float:left;width: 325px;}
.main_3r{margin: 0;float:right;width: 325px;/*padding-left:15px;*/}

.xnyw {width:475px;/*height:300px;*/float:right;}
.xnyw_head {width:470px;height:35px;background:url(../images/bg_xxtb.jpg) no-repeat;margin:0 auto;}
.more{float: right;padding: 12px 15px 0px;}
.xnyw_head dt {font-size:18px;font-family:微软雅黑;font-weight:bold;color:#940214;line-height:35px;height:35px;padding-left:38px;}
.xnyw_head span{float:right;line-height:30px;padding-right:10px;}
.xnyw_head span a{font-size:12px;color:#878181;}
.xnyw_cont{width:465px;}
.xnyw_cont ul{padding:10px 10px 5px 10px;}
.xnyw_cont li{padding-left: 10px;background: url(../images/heidian.png) no-repeat left; border-bottom:1px dashed #d8d8d8;font-size: 14px;line-height:35px;width: 465px;}
.xnyw_cont li a:hover{color:#940214;}
.xnyw_cont li a{color:#000;font-family:微软雅黑;}
.xnyw_cont span{float: right;color: #000;font-size: 15px;padding-right: 10px;}

.lbdt {width:475px;float:left;}

.lbdt_head {width:470px;height:35px;float:right;background:url(../images/bg_kjdh3.jpg) no-repeat;margin:0 auto;}
.more{float: right;padding: 12px 15px 0px;}
.lbdt_head dt {font-size:18px;font-family:微软雅黑;font-weight:bold;color:#940214;height:35px;line-height:35px;padding-left:40px;}
.lbdt_head span{float:right;line-height:30px;padding-right:10px;}
.lbdt_head span a{font-size:12px;color:#878181;}
.lbdt_cont{width:465px;float:left;}
.lbdt_cont ul{padding:10px 10px 5px 10px;}
.lbdt_cont li{padding-left: 10px;background: url(../images/heidian.png) no-repeat left; border-bottom:1px dashed #d8d8d8;font-size: 14px;line-height:35px; width: 465px;}
.lbdt_cont li a:hover{color:#940214;}
.lbdt_cont li a{color:#000;font-family:微软雅黑;}
.lbdt_cont span{float: right;color: #000;font-size: 15px;padding-right: 10px;}

.gzyg {width:315px;float:left;margin: 0 10px 0 0;}
.gzyg_head {width:310px;height:35px;background:url(../images/bg_kjdh2.jpg) no-repeat;margin:0 auto;}
.more{float: right;padding: 12px 15px 0px;}
.gzyg_head dt {font-size:18px;font-family:"Microsoft YaHei";font-weight:bold;color:#940214;line-height:35px;height:35px;padding-left:38px;}
.gzyg_head span{float:right;line-height:30px;padding-right:10px;}
.gzyg_head span a{font-size:12px;color:#878181;}
.gzyg_cont{width:305px;}
.gzyg_cont ul{width:305px;10px 10px 5px 10px;}
.gzyg_cont li{padding-left: 10px;background: url(../images/heidian.png) no-repeat left;border-bottom:1px dashed #d8d8d8;font-size: 14px;line-height:35px;width: 305px;}
.gzyg_cont li a:hover{color:#940214;}
.gzyg_cont li a{color:#000;font-family:"Microsoft YaHei";}
.gzyg_cont ul li span{float: right;color: #000;font-size: 15px;padding-right: 10px;}


.tzgg {width:325px;/*height:300px;*/float:left;margin: 0 auto;}
.tzgg_head {width:320px;height:35px;background:url(../images/bg_kjdh5.jpg) no-repeat;margin:0 auto;}
.more{float: right;padding: 12px 15px 0px;}
.tzgg_head dt {font-size:18px;font-family:"Microsoft YaHei";font-weight:bold;color:#940214;line-height:35px;height:35px;padding-left:38px;}
.tzgg_head span{float:right;line-height:30px;padding-right:10px;}
.tzgg_head span a{font-size:12px;color:#878181;}
.tzgg_cont{width:315px;}
.tzgg_cont ul{width:315px;padding:10px 10px 5px 10px;}
.tzgg_cont li{padding-left: 10px;background: url(../images/heidian.png) no-repeat left;border-bottom:1px dashed #d8d8d8;font-size: 14px;line-height:35px;width:315px;}
.tzgg_cont li a:hover{color:#940214;}
.tzgg_cont li a{color:#000;font-family:"Microsoft YaHei";}
.tzgg_cont ul li span{float: right;color: #000;font-size: 15px;padding-right: 10px;}

.gzzd {width:315px;/*height:300px;*/float:right;margin: 0 0 0 5px;}
.gzzd_head {width:310px;height:35px;background:url(../images/bg_kjdh2.jpg) no-repeat;margin:0 auto;}
.more{float: right;padding: 12px 15px 0px;}
.gzzd_head dt {font-size:18px;font-family:"Microsoft YaHei";font-weight:bold;color:#940214;line-height:35px;height:35px;padding-left:38px;}
.gzzd_head span{float:right;line-height:30px;padding-right:10px;}
.gzzd_head span a{font-size:12px;color:#878181;}
.gzzd_cont{width:305px;}
.gzzd_cont ul{width:305px;padding:10px 10px 5px 10px;}
.gzzd_cont li{padding-left: 10px;background: url(../images/heidian.png) no-repeat left;border-bottom:1px dashed #d8d8d8;font-size: 14px;line-height:35px;width: 305px;}
.gzzd_cont li a:hover{color:#940214;}
.gzzd_cont li a{color:#000;font-family:"Microsoft YaHei";}
.gzzd_cont ul li span{float: right;color: #000;font-size: 15px;padding-right: 10px;}

.kjdh {width:365px;float:left;}
.kjdh_head {width:365px;height:35px;float:right;background:url(../images/bg_kjdh6.png) no-repeat;margin:0 auto;}
.more{float: right;padding: 12px 15px 0px;}
.kjdh_head dt {font-size:18px;font-family:"Microsoft YaHei";font-weight:bold;color:#940214;height:35px;line-height:35px;padding-left:40px;}
.kjdh_cont{width:363px;float:left;border-left:1px dotted #f3ede2;border-right:1px dotted #f3ede2;border-bottom:1px dotted #f3ede2;}

/* More info */

.foot{font-size:14px;height:85px;background:#940214;margin:0 auto;margin-top: 5px;}
.foot p{font-size:14px;color:#fff;font-family: "Microsoft YaHei";}